CONNECTIONS IN MIND

Connections in Mind is a group of organisations committed to raising awareness of executive function skills and their impact on people’s development and relationships. CIM was started in 2016 by Dr Bettina Hohnen, Imogen Moore-Shelley and Victoria Bagnall and pioneered Executive Function Coaching in the UK. Today they are one of leaders of Executive Function Coaching with Certification.

SMARTS EF®

SMARTS EF® is a holistic, research-based executive functioning (EF) framework and curriculum for all learners in grades 2-16. It helps them learn self-understanding and basic EF strategies that promote self-confidence, resilience, and academic success—areas that are critical for success in school and life. For Learners With and Without  Learning Differences.

CONNECT & COMMUNICATE - "360" Thinking

The model is the brainchild of Kristen Jacobsen, MS, CCC-SLP, and Sarah Ward, MS, CCC-SLP, who are co-directors of Cognitive Connections Executive Function Practice, LLP. The 360 Thinking executive function model and programme, is helping a growing number of individuals with executive function challenges  enjoy the autonomy, independence, and self- confidence when they are taught this programme.

SAFEGUARDING

SAFEGUARDING is the prevention of impairment to children’s physical and psychological health and wellbeing while providing circumstances that enable healthy development. In 2020,  ChildSafeguarding.com became the first universally accessible Child Protection training for all adults in schools.
